EQUIPMENT QUALIFICATION NO. 2 UNIT SALEM NUCLEAR GENERATING STATION DOCKET NO. 50-311 PSE&G submitted its report on Equipment Qualification and Compliance with NUREG-0588 by letter dated August 25, 1980.

Subsequently, an audit was conducted by members of your staff on September 8 and 9, 1980 at PSE&G headquarters in Newark, New Jersey.

PSE&G will respond to the requirements specified during the audit by September 19, 1980.

The information to be sub-mitted will include a "classification of use by safety significance" of the items previously identified in our August 25, 1980 submittal, a tabulation of equipment by classification group, justification for interim use and a schedule for correction for the cases identified as possible problems, a discussion of the Quality Assurance activities pertinent to the review of NUREG-0588, and identification of exceptions to NUREG-0588 requirements.
